Output 12e57cd8092470e4768623a102f542a43d548786ed14293c7242ac59e662f66d:1

value
13589652
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44932f9ff671f09695f97eb0a9461ed4dc590a30 OP_EQUALVERIFY OP_CHECKSIG
address
17FbGi9Yh86J191qHojmtcDnqe6V6MtWKF
transaction
12e57cd8092470e4768623a102f542a43d548786ed14293c7242ac59e662f66d
spent
true